New offering to drive higher performance and boost profitability for System z customers

Temenos Community Forum, Lisbon, 23 May 2011 – Temenos (SIX: TEMN), the global provider of banking software today launches T24 Enterprise Java Edition (T24E Java Edition), the new Java and component based version of TEMENOS T24 (T24) designed for use by the world’s largest banks. As part of this launch, Temenos unveils results of a major benchmark which illustrate the high performance of the new product running natively on IBM’s System z servers, fully exploiting the advancedfeatures that System z users benefit from today.

T24E Java Edition combines the industry’s most efficient core banking software with IBM System z, the unrivalled platform of choice for large scale banks globally, including the top 120 global banks and the top 50 US banks. These banks can now acquire a modern, cost effective and highly scalable core banking solution combined with the highest levels of resilience, reliable performance and rich, mature and proven control environment of System z.

T24E underwent validation by Temenos and IBM engineers to confirm its native suitability for the System z platform, proven using an environment designed to reflect real world retail banking activity. T24E was shown to fully exploit advanced System z features such as Sysplex and DB2 Data Sharing, providing massive levels of scalability and resilience. It was also shown to efficiently utilise IBM’s advanced WebSphere platform to offload up to 80% of its workload onto IBM low cost specialist zAAP processors, providing a more cost efficient solution for System z users. Whilst the benchmark was not designed to test maximum performance, IBM and Temenos were pleased to note that IBM System z processed the highest number of transactions per processor per second compared to T24 benchmarks on other platforms.

IBM has also granted T24E Java Edition certification for the IBM Banking Industry Framework for Core Banking Transformation, its foundation for the incremental modernisation of a bank's core systems.

T24E Java Edition provides the best option for IBM mainframe users to successfully migrate from legacy core banking systems in a risk controlled manner and improve their performance, profitability and customer service.

About Temenos
Founded in 1993 and listed on the Swiss Stock Exchange (SIX: TEMN), Temenos Group AG is a global provider of banking software systems in the Retail, Corporate & Correspondent, Universal, Private, Islamic and Microfinance & Community banking markets. Headquartered in Geneva with more than 60 offices worldwide, Temenos serves over 1100 customers in more than 120 countries. Temenos’ software products provide advanced technology and rich functionality, incorporating best practice processes that leverage Temenos’ experience in over 600 implementations around the globe. Temenos’ advanced and automated implementation approach, provided by its strong Client Services organisation, ensures efficient and low-risk core banking platform migrations. Temenos is top of the IBS Sales League Table 2010; winner every year since its launch of the Best Core Banking Product in Banking Technology magazine’s Readers’ Choice Awards and ranks 26th in the American Banker top 100 FinTech companies. Temenos customers are proven to be more profitable than their peers: data from The Banker – top 1000 banks shows that Temenos’ customers enjoy a 54% higher return on assets, a 62% higher return on capital and a cost/income ratio that is 7.2 points lower than non-Temenos customers.
